A Timely Cherokee Legend
An old Cherokee is teaching his grandson about life. "A fight is going on inside me," he said to the boy. "It is a terrible fight and it is between two wolves. One is evil - he is anger, envy, sorrow, regret, greed, arrogance, fear, self-pity, guilt, resentment, vengeance, inferiority, lies, false pride, superiority, and ego."
 
He continued, "The other is good - he is joy, peace, love, hope, serenity, humility, kindness, benevolence, empathy, generosity, truth, compassion, and faith. The same fight is going on inside you - and inside every other person, too."
 
The grandson thought about it for a minute and then asked his grandfather, "Which wolf will win?"
 
The old Cherokee simply replied, "The one you feed."
 
Which One are You Feeding?
 
Every moment of every day, we all make the choice of which of these "wolves" to feed. Sometimes it is a conscious choice, sometimes not. Sometimes it is an obvious choice, sometimes not. Sometimes it is a difficult choice, sometimes not. When we consciously choose to feed the "evil wolf," we usually do so with elaborate justifications about why it is the right choice. The justifications usually include language about pride, patriotism, God’s will, safety and security, and/or past or present grievances. And we are often "fed" the choice—or at the very least, provided with the justification for making it—by the culture, by the media, or by our families, friends and peers who have already made the choice to feed the evil wolf.
 
We are offered that choice more and more these days, as events in the outer world seem to be more and more violent, more and more outrageous and horrific. We are definitely offered the choice when we see millions of refugees fleeing for their lives from war and oppression, juxtaposed alongside radical, violent extremists claiming their violent actions are motivated by religion. Adding to the mix, we have people in positions of respect and authority fomenting fear by claiming that everyone of that religion—refugees and extremists alike—share the same beliefs and violent tendencies.
 
Is it simply human nature to find a large number of people that share something in common—be it race, color, religion, nationality, or political view—and turn them all collectively into the boogey man because "they are not like us"? Looking back over decades of this behavior, one has to wonder: Over and over again in history we have seen it, almost every nationality has been placed into this category by some other nationality, and the members of almost every religion have been placed into this category by those practicing some other religion. In Europe and the Middle East, the "holy wars" (there’s a concept!) raged for centuries, Catholics against "heretics and infidels," protestants against Catholics, gentiles against Jews. The religious wars in Ireland began in the mid-1500s, and (open) hostilities finally ended in the early 21st Century. Periodic conflicts and tensions between Shia and Sunni Muslims began in the 600s. And let’s not forget the witch trials or the legendary Hatfields and McCoys, who allegedly carried out a bitter blood feud over many generations.
 
In the last 70 years, the U.S. has placed Japanese-Americans in internment camps and arrested, reviled, and ruined any person that anyone else claimed might possibly be a "Commie." (If you don’t remember what happened to Japanese-Americans after the Pearl Harbor attack, or you don’t remember McCarthyism in the 50s, take the time to read up!).
 
Do humans actually need a "common enemy" to turn against, do we just enjoy it, or are we taught to do that? And, as anyone knows who was bullied in school for being short, fat, smart, wearing glasses, or being different in any way from some perceived norm—or anyone who is poor and needs unemployment benefits, welfare, or food stamps due to a death, divorce, or downsizing—being demonized, reviled, and persecuted is not just reserved for those who are dangerous.
 
History has shown over and over again that groups of people can do terrible things to other people when they have been taught to fear them (and we are often taught that by those who will profit in wealth or power from that induced fear). We demonize an entire race of people or all the members of a religion when a few members of that race or religion act out and do violent things. And now we have elected officials and media personalities who, in our 24/7 news cycle, seem determined to convince everyone that all Muslims hold exactly the same views and, for our safety, we must fear and loathe them, even those who are fleeing their homes for their lives to get away from other Muslims who are creating havoc, disruption, and war, or those who were born here or have lived peacefully in the country for decades. It seems that we forget there have been many so-called Christian terrorists, as well.
 
Why would we believe that all members of any nation, race, or religion, are exactly alike? Are all Christians alike in their beliefs or the tenets to which they adhere? Of course not. How many Catholics eschew birth control, as traditionally taught in Catholicism? How many still believe divorce is a sin? Although these doctrines are taught, many, many Catholics do not follow them. Yet we are asked by some to believe that all Muslims believe and practice the same precepts being used to justify violence by a group that may or may not be acting from a religious, rather than political, agenda.
 
It really is time for humanity to learn that most things are not just "black or white," even though it may be easier or more expeditious to believe that they are. Most things are, at the very least, "50 Shades of Gray"! It’s time to realize that we are all different and, while we can always find others who look, feel, believe, think, and act the same, it is a fallacy to think that "all men," "all women," "all Americans," "all Christians," "all Catholics," or "all" anything are alike in all ways. Certainly there are people in every walk of life, in every race, culture, and religion who act in bad and sometimes very violent ways, but they are the minority.
 
Would all Christians withhold marriage licenses from gay couples as one woman did in Kentucky? No! Are all white Southerners merely waiting to walk into traditionally black churches to gun down worshippers? No! Are all police officers racist or quick to shoot? No! Would any of us like to be judged, condemned, and demonized merely because of our race, nationality, religion, or even our profession, because someone else became violent and did horrendous things? NO!
 
Trying to make things a simple choice between one extreme or another, or to demonize and label an entire category of people, results from lazy, illogical thinking, and a lack of taking responsibility for one’s thoughts, beliefs, and discernment.

First they came for the Socialists, and I did not speak out—
Because I was not a Socialist.

Then they came for the Trade Unionists, and I did not speak out—
Because I was not a Trade Unionist.
Then they came for the Jews, and I did not speak out—
Because I was not a Jew.
Then they came for me—and there was no one left to speak for me.
 
Martin Niemoller, German Protestant Pastor, who spoke out against Nazism and passive collusion
